The Importance of Local Sourcing


Sourcing bamboo locally has multiple benefits. It supports local economies and reduces transportation emissions. By using bamboo, we also contribute to the preservation of our environment. Bamboo grows quickly and absorbs carbon dioxide, making it an excellent choice for sustainable construction.
